Our Therapeutic Approach to Family Counseling

At AmberSky Counseling, we use evidence-based, relational approaches to help families strengthen communication, navigate challenges, and create lasting change. We focus on the family as a whole, exploring the patterns and dynamics that shape your relationships.

Our work is collaborative and tailored to your family’s unique needs, creating space for each member to feel heard, understood, and supported.

Family Systems Therapy

Focuses on how family members interact and influence one another, helping shift patterns toward healthier dynamics.

Helps establish clearer roles and boundaries to create greater balance and stability within the family.

Strengthens emotional bonds by improving communication and fostering deeper understanding between family members.

Supports families in processing difficult experiences while building safety, trust, and resilience together.

Frequently Asked Questions About Family Counseling

Who should attend family counseling sessions?

Family counseling can include parents, children, or other important family members depending on your situation. Your therapist will help determine who should participate to best support your goals.

It is common for some family members to feel unsure at first. Even starting with a few participants can create meaningful change, and others may choose to join over time.
